Effect of organic matter on mobilization of antimony from nanocrystalline titanium dioxide

Antimony (Sb) is of increasing environmental concern worldwide. The sorption behavior of Sb was investigated. Both Sb(III) and Sb(V) were likely to be sorbed onto nanocrystalline titanium dioxide (TiO2). Sorption studies showed that the Sb(V) sorption capacity and rate for TiO2 were greater than tho...
